Nonaxion solution of the problem of CP conservation in strong interactions

A new model based on the gauge group SU(9) xSU(2)xU(1) furnishes a natural explanation of why the CP nonconservation is slight in strong interactions, without hypothesizing the existence of an axion. Supersymmetry models can also explain the absence of strong CP violation.
